Detailed information for compound 1408017

Basic information

Technical information
  • TDR Targets ID: 1408017
  • Name: N-[4-[(4-methylphenyl)sulfamoyl]phenyl]thioph ene-2-carboxamide
  • MW: 372.461 | Formula: C18H16N2O3S2
  • H donors: 2 H acceptors: 3 LogP: 3.66 Rotable bonds: 6
    Rule of 5 violations (Lipinski): 1
  • SMILES: Cc1ccc(cc1)NS(=O)(=O)c1ccc(cc1)NC(=O)c1cccs1
  • InChi: 1S/C18H16N2O3S2/c1-13-4-6-15(7-5-13)20-25(22,23)16-10-8-14(9-11-16)19-18(21)17-3-2-12-24-17/h2-12,20H,1H3,(H,19,21)
  • InChiKey: PVEOWTQKISAPJC-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
Potency (functional) 0.206 uM PUBCHEM_BIOASSAY: qHTS screen for small molecules that inhibit ELG1-dependent DNA repair in human embryonic kidney (HEK293T) cells expressing luciferase-tagged ELG1.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ID493107, AID493125] ChEMBL. No reference
Potency (functional) 0.3294 uM PUBCHEM_BIOASSAY: Primary qHTS for delayed death inhibitors of the malarial parasite plastid, 96 hour incubation.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ID488745, AID488752, AID488774, AID504848, AID504850] ChEMBL. No reference
Potency (functional) 6.3096 uM PubChem BioAssay. qHTS for Agonist of gsp, the Etiologic Mutation Responsible for Fibrous Dysplasia/McCune-Albright Syndrome: qHTS.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) = 10 um PUBCHEM_BIOASSAY: qHTS for Inhibitors of Tau Fibril Formation, Fluorescence Polarization. (Class of assay: confirmatory) [Related pubchem assays: 596 ] ChEMBL. No reference
Potency (functional) 18.3564 uM PUBCHEM_BIOASSAY: Nrf2 qHTS screen for inhibitors.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ID493153, AID493163, AID504648] ChEMBL. No reference
Potency (functional) 28.1838 uM PUBCHEM_BIOASSAY: qHTS for Inhibitors of Polymerase Iota.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ID588623] ChEMBL. No reference
